How bad is this?

So I bought a drop kit from LMC and AFTER I had ripped the front end off I noticed that there was a small nick on the right spendle. I took the pic this morning so it's not the greatest shot. The nick doesn't look too bad, but its the location of it that concerns me. I could send them back, but I figured if I could get away with sanding it down then that would keep me from being out of my truck for 2 weeks. So what do you think? Is it bad enough to send it back?

Re: How bad is this?

Take a file and just knock off the high spot of the nick, don't actually removed any from the main surface area and you'll be fine. Test fit your inner bearing so you know it will slide on without binding up. Something that small will not make a difference.
